Murex Welding Products have announced new City and Guilds Accredited Gas Equipment Inspectors training courses for 2007.
Murex Welding Products have announced new City and Guilds Accredited Gas Equipment Inspectors training courses for 2007 These courses are designed to provide qualifications which allow individuals to conduct full safety checks on oxy-fuel gas welding systems

The two day qualification courses are conducted in the Hertfordshire area and residential accommodation is provided.
Anyone responsible for the practical safety aspects of oxy-fuel gas systems will benefit from the course including safety officers, maintenance staff, supervisors or technical college and school lecturers.

The training course lasts 2 days with the first part involving theoretical instruction on oxy-fuel gas safety, the properties of gases, safe use and operation of systems.
The second day of the course is entirely devoted to practical training and "hands on" sessions teach the candidates how to fully test an oxy-fuel gas station and pass it off for safe use.
Each candidate receives a detailed test manual and his own comprehensive tool kit to carry out the tests and inspection work.
